Company: Ashgrove Components Ltd

This page summarises the Q3 forecast for heads of department. Operating inflows are projected at a 6% increase over Q2, driven mainly by the Lindfall supply agreement. Outflows rise in parallel due to scheduled equipment replacement at the Wrenport site and a one-off severance provision. Net position remains positive throughout the quarter, with the tightest week falling mid-cycle. Department heads should submit spend deferral options before the next review. The confidential planning note follows below.

board note of fahif-yahog: Gross margin on Wenath came in at 10 percent against a plan of 5 percent. Only 3 of the 100 pilot accounts renewed Wenath, so a churn review is set for July 15.

**Q: How do I access the Farelight pricing experiment dashboard?**

Contractors get read-only access to the Farelight ticket-pricing experiment by default. Variant assignments and revenue deltas live in the experiment console. If the console locks you out mid-session, use the recovery flow; it asks for the experiment recovery passphrase, listed directly below.

strongbox words: fenwyn-tamys-norys-lamius-gilion-gilath

## Changelog — Tidemark Widget 3.2

Defaults changed. Read before touching anything.

- Refresh interval now hourly, not every 15 min. Harbor feeds from the Pellisport aggregator throttle aggressive polling.
- Lunar-offset correction is on by default. Disable only for legacy Kestrel Bay deployments.
- Chart units default to metric. The imperial fallback flag is deprecated and will be removed in 3.4.
- Cache eviction is now time-based, not size-based.

New installs should start from the default configuration values listed below.

config for kahap-taweg:
oliox:
  pin: 8609
  tenant: casath
  seal: seal_632a4a6f
  metrics_host: metrics.oliox.nelvrogrid.example
  standby_team: keleth
  escalation: briiel-oliwyn
  nonce: e2397c